Why Flexible Lift Beds Are Beneficial for Your Well-being?
How can flexible lift beds help improve better health? These beds offer personalized support that can improve sleep quality and reduce discomfort. By allowing users to adjust their position, they can relieve pressure on specific body areas, which is particularly beneficial for individuals with chronic pain or mobility issues. Elevating the head can help those suffering from conditions like acid reflux or sleep apnea, encouraging better breathing and digestion during sleep.
Moreover, modifiable lift beds can improve circulation by enabling users to lift their legs, cutting down on swelling and supporting venous return. This feature is notably advantageous for elderly individuals or those healing from surgery. Additionally, the flexibility of these beds creates a more restful sleep environment, resulting in improved overall well-being. Ultimately, adjustable lift beds act as a valuable tool in promoting healthier sleep habits and enhancing physical comfort, rendering them a worthy choice for health-conscious people.
Deciding on the Optimal Adjustable Lift Bed for Your Needs
Selecting the right adjustable lift bed requires understanding personal needs and preferences. Buyers ought to take into account factors such as mattress type, weight capacity, and the selection of positions offered by the bed. Various mattresses, like memory foam and latex, may greatly affect comfort and support. Also, understanding the weight capacity is vital for safety and durability.
The bed's flexibility features, such as raising the head and foot, should align with particular medical requirements or lifestyle choices. For example, individuals with acid reflux may benefit from a higher head position, while those with mobility issues might opt for a more elevated foot section.
Moreover, the size of the frame and how well it fits with current bedroom furniture play important roles in the decision-making process. Aesthetics, ease of use, and remote control capabilities are added considerations that can enhance the overall experience. Ultimately, thorough assessment of these elements will ensure the best choice in adjustable lift beds.

Lubrication and Maintenance Calendar
Proper application of oil is fundamental for achieving the smooth operation of an adjustable lift bed. Regular maintenance should consist of assessing the bed’s moving components, such as motors and joints, every three months. It is advisable to use a silicone-based lubricant to avoid accumulated dust, which can reduce functionality.
Additionally, property holders should inspect the power supply and control mechanisms for any signs of deterioration or harm. Keeping the bed frame clean and clear of debris will also prolong its useful life.
Conducting a comprehensive annual inspection by a professional can notice any possible issues before they escalate. By following this schedule for lubrication and upkeep, users can boost the lifespan and functionality of their adjustable lift beds, guaranteeing maximum comfort and reliability.

Are Adjustable Lift Beds Compatible with All Mattress Types?
Adjustable lift beds typically are fit for most mattress types, including memory foam, latex, and hybrid mattresses. Yet, it’s key to follow manufacturer guidelines, as certain innerspring models may not perform well with adjustable bases.

What represents the mean life span of an adaptable lift bed?
The typical lifespan of an lift bed that can be adjusted typically ranges from 10 to 20 years, depending on the quality of materials, usage, and maintenance. Regular care can extend its durability and functionality over time.
